The
drug works by blocking two important metabolic pathways that the
leukemia cells need to grow and spread.
When an existing
drug was given that blocks the DNP in a
leukemia cell, the dCTP nucleotide was still produced by the NSP and the
leukemia cell survived.
When both these
drugs are given, both pathways are blocked with a one - two punch, the
leukemia cells can not produce dCTP nucleotides, and the cells die.
